What is case, case type , case life cycle, stage, process, steps ?
Case- Case is a specific instance of case type.
Case Type- Case type is an abstract model of business transaction.
Case Life Cycle- A case life cycle is a complete cycle of business transaction.
Stage- Stage contains series of processes and steps. A stage indicates a transition of work from one department to another.
Step – A Step is an action or task performed by the users or system.
What is SLA? Goal, Deadline and Passed deadline?
SLA- stand for Service Level Agreement. It establishes a work completion deadline.
Goal- It is ideal amount of time in which the work should be completed.
Deadline- Deadline is the maximum amount of time in which the work must be completed.
Passed Deadline- Passed deadline start when the deadline will be finsh.

What is Worklist, Workbasket, Sys-lock?
Worklist- Worklist is a container of tasks. It refers to a specific user.
Workbasket- Workbasket is a container of tasks. It refers to a set of users.
Sys-lock- Only one user can work on a particular assignment. If other want to work on it. It will give an error. eg- Someone is already working on it.
What is Routing?
When there are 2 or more users work on a case then we use routing to assign a particular work to a particular user.
Types 1. Current 2. Specific User (Worklist) 3. Workqueue (Set of Users) 4. Business Logic (If, Else) 5. Custom (Expression, Activity)

What automation shapes and advanced shapes?
Automation shapes- Automation Shapes automatically perform the task without user interaction.
1. Send Email
2. Change to a Specific Stage
3. Change to Next Stage
4. Create Case
5. Wait – Pause and resume the flow for a specific time.
Advanced Shapes-
1. Split Join- To define 2 or more sub-processes that can run independently but in parallel later they can rejoin.
2. Split for-each – Using a Split for each flow shape, we can call one sub-flow, and pass a pagelist parameter.

What is Locking?
Pega Platform locks the case to prevent other users from applying any changes.
1. Allow one user (Default) – Only one user can work at a time.
2. Allow multiple users (Optimistic) – Multiple users can work on the same time but Who will submit first their changes will reflect on the server and other users will get a popup screen and ask them to refresh the page and their changes maybe lost.

Difference between Process Flow and Screen Flow?
Process Flow | Screen Flow |
---|---|
1. It can create a work object. | It can’t create a work object. |
2. For every assignment we see submit button, which means when an assignment is completed we can’t navigate back. | For every assignment, we get the next, back, and finish buttons available. We can navigate between assignments. |
3. Harness can be called on each assignment. | The harness can be called on start shape. |
4. Routing is available on assignment shape. | Routing is available on Start shape. |
5. Flow action can be called on assignment shape onward connector. Here we can call multiple flow-action per assignment. | Flow actions can be called on the assignment shape itself only one flow action per assignment is possible. |

How to route a step to a specific person?
1. Create Persona in App Studio (Manager)
2. Create Channel and then delete existing channel (ManagerPortal)
3. Goto Dev Studio then on bottm left corner click on profile icon and then click on Operator
4. Click on Save as to copy the same operator and change the name of the Operator (ManagerOperator)
5. Go to the Newly created operator and Access Group section then choose the desired Persona (eg: KYCApp:Manager)
6. Then Click on the Target icon then choose the desired portal (e.g:ManagerPortal)
7. Then Go to Case Type then choose the step which you want to route
8. Choose Route to Specific
9. Enter Username (ManagerOperator) then Save
10. After that login with Newly Created operator (E.g: ManagerOperator) check their worklist (Task added there).
